Continental Device India Limited Data Sheet Page 1 of 3 SILICON N–P–N HIGH–VOLTAGE TRANSISTORS N–P–N high–voltage small–signal transistors Marking BSR19 = U35 BSR19A = U36 ABSOLUTE MAXIMUM RATINGS BSR19 BSR19A Collector–base voltage (open emitter) V CB0 max. 160 180 V Collector–emitter voltage (open base) V CE0 max. 140 160 V Collector current I C max. 600 600 mA Total power dissipation up to T amb = 25 °C P tot max. 250 250 mW Junction temperature T j max. 150 150 ° C Collector–emitter saturation voltage IC = 50 mA; l B = 5 mA V CEsat max. 0,25 0,20 V D.C. current gain IC = 10 mA; V CE = 5 V h FE min. 60 80 BSR19 BSR19A PACKAGE OUTLINE DETAILS ALL DIMENSIONS IN m m Pin configuration 1 = BASE 2 = EMITTER 3 = COLLECTOR Continental Device India Limited An IS/ISO 9002 and IECQ Certified Manufacturer SOT-23 Formed SMD Package IS/ISO 9002 Lic# QSC/L- 000019.2
Continental Device India Limited Data Sheet Page 2 of 3 RATINGS (at T A = 25°C unless otherwise specified) Limiting values Collector–base voltage (open emitter) V CB0 max. 160 180 V Collector–emitter voltage (open base) V CE0 max. 140 160 V Emitter–base voltage (open collector) V EB0 max. 6 V Collector current I C max. 600 mA Total power dissipation up to T amb = 25 °C P tot max. 250 mW Junction temperature T j max. 150 ° C Storage temperature Tstg –55 to +150 ° C THERMAL RESISTANCE From junction to ambient R th j–a = 500 K/W CHARACTERISTICS Tarnb = 25 °C unless otherwise specified BSR19 BSR19A Collector cut–off current IE = 0; V CB = 100 V I CBO max. 100 nA IE = 0; V CB = 120 V I CBO max. 50 nA IE = 0; V CB = 100 V; T amb = 100°C I CBO max. 100 mA IE = 0; V CB = 120 V; T amb = 100°C I CBO max. 50 mA Emitter cut–off current IC = 0; V EB = 4,0 V I EBO max. 50 50 nA Breakdown voltages IC: 1,0 mA; I B = 0 V(BR) CEO min. 140 160 V IC = 100 mA; IE = 0 V(BR) CBO min. 160 180 V IC = 0; I E = 10 mA V(BR) EBO min. 6,0 6,0 V Saturation voltages IC = 10 mA; I B = 1,0 mA V CEsat max. 0,15 0,15 V VBEsat max. 1,0 1,0 V IC = 50mA; I B = 5,0 mA V CEsat max. 0,25 0,20 V VBEsat max. 1,2 1,0 V D.C. current gain IC = 1,0 mA; V CE = 5 V h FE min. 60 80 IC = 10 mA; V CE = 5 V h FE min. 60 80 max. 250 250 IC = 50 mA; V CE = 5 V h FE min. 20 30 Small–signal current gain IC = 1,0 mA; V CE = 10 V; f = 1 kHz h fe min. 50 50 max. 200 200 Output capacitance at f = 1 MHz I E = 0; V CB = 10 V C o max. 6 6 pF BSR19 BSR19A
Continental Device India Limited Data Sheet Page 3 of 3 BSR19 BSR19A Input capacitance at f = 1 MHz IC = 0; V EB = 0,5 V Ci max. 30 30 pF Transition frequency at f = 100 MHz IC = 10 mA; V CE = 10 V f T min. 100 100 MHz max. 300 300 MHz Noise figure at RS = 1 k W IC = 250 mA; VCE = 5 V; f = 10Hz to 15,7 kHz F max. 10 8 dB BSR19 BSR19A Disclaimer The product information and the selection guides facilitate selection of the CDIL's Discrete Semiconductor Device(s) best suited for application in your product(s) as per your requirement.
